Two militiawomen observe the situation of fishing boats on the sea at Leigong Mountain before the approaching of typhoon in Wenling, east China's Zhejiang Province, on August 6, 2009. The eye of Typhoon Morakot was located at 840 kilometers east off Fuzhou City of southeast China's Fujian Province as of 11 a.m. Thursday. The Office of State Flood Control and Drought Relief Headquarters expected Morakot to strengthen into a strong typhoon and to make landfall from Saturday noon to Sunday morning. The national flood control administration announced the III level emergency alert and called for full preparation for the strong typhoon Morakot. [Wang Dingchang/Xinhua]
